### v3.2.0 — Renamed setting

Keyspindle no longer reads `KS_ROTATE_TOKEN`; it was renamed for consistency with the plugin API. Plugins targeting 3.2+ must use the new name or rotation hooks will not fire. The old name is ignored silently — no deprecation warning is emitted. Update your `.env` before upgrading. Keep `KS_PLUGIN_DIR` and `KS_LOG_LEVEL` as-is. Immediately after those entries, add the renamed token line with your existing value.

secret setting of kawif-kajef: COURIER_KEY3=d2b

Runbook: migrating the Oxhollow build to the hermetic build system (Kilncraft). All network access during compilation is now blocked; every dependency must come from the pinned artifact mirror. For the security review, note that toolchain binaries are content-addressed and verified against the lockfile at fetch time, so tampering with the mirror is detectable. Legacy scripts that shell out to system tools will fail and must be wrapped. The full migration checklist and attestation format are documented on the internal page below.

operations page: https://jenkins.zemvarcloud.local/job/merge_requests/repo/build/73930b4b30f0a8ed

Handover — Deng to Priya (Coldspire ledger DB)

Monthly partitions on `tx_events` created through next March. Cron `part-roller` adds new ones on the 25th; check it didn't fail silently before each release cut. Old partitions detach after 13 months, no auto-drop. Archive vault needs manual unlock; the passphrase is on the next line.

unlock words, hahip-baduf: holwyn-istath-julvan